Transaction 162895800d91120b45e958fa7dd2204808ce581c076613559663265570565741
1 Input
1 Output
-
162895800d91120b45e958fa7dd2204808ce581c076613559663265570565741:0
- value
- 308274
- script pubkey
- OP_0 OP_PUSHBYTES_20 95f1455f6b691fb628eff78b13fd63e9edf5deb5
- address
- bc1qjhc52hmtdy0mv28077938ltra8klth448p0ptr